5.1 Overview of the DegenFi Memecoin Derivatives Market

  1. Memecoin Futures Contracts Futures contracts enable investors to buy or sell Memecoins at a predetermined price on a specific future date. DegenFi offers multiple types of futures, helping investors take advantage of Memecoin’s price fluctuations:

  • Standard Futures: Users open positions at the current market price and close them on a specified date in the future, profiting from price differences.

  • Long Futures: For bullish investors who expect Memecoin prices to rise. They buy futures now and sell at a higher price upon contract expiration to capture the price difference.

  • Short Futures: For bearish investors who expect prices to drop. They sell futures now and later buy back at a lower price, profiting from the difference.

  • Inverse Futures: Allow users to short Memecoins. For instance, if they anticipate a price decline, they borrow Memecoins, sell them, then buy back at a lower price to repay the borrowed tokens and pocket the difference.

  1. Memecoin Options Options grant the holder the right—but not the obligation—to buy or sell Memecoins at a predetermined price on or before a certain date. DegenFi supports both major types:

  • Call Options: Give holders the right to buy Memecoins at a specified strike price by the expiration date. Suitable for those bullish on Memecoin prices.

  • Put Options: Give holders the right to sell Memecoins at a specified strike price by the expiration date. Suitable for those bearish on Memecoin prices.

  1. Memecoin Leverage Trading Leverage trading allows users to borrow additional funds to increase their trading positions, amplifying returns. DegenFi supports various leverage multiples (e.g., 2x, 3x, 5x, 10x):

  • Leverage Multiples: By borrowing funds, traders with smaller initial capital can open significantly larger positions. For example, with $1,000 and 10x leverage, a user can manage a $10,000 position.

  • Leverage Risks: While it can amplify returns, leverage also magnifies losses. DegenFi implements smart risk control to ensure the safety of leverage trading.

5.2 Enhancing User Experience and Risk Management

  1. Dynamic Volatility Derivatives To better reflect real-time market conditions, DegenFi employs a dynamic volatility model that automatically updates futures and options pricing based on Memecoin market fluctuations:

  • Real-Time Volatility Adjustments: DegenFi adjusts implied volatility for futures and options contracts according to Memecoin’s live market volatility. This ensures contract pricing aligns with actual market conditions.

  • Market Sentiment Monitoring: The platform uses AI to evaluate social media, news, and on-chain data, predicting potential price swings in Memecoin and adjusting derivatives’ risk premiums accordingly.

  1. Auto-Close Options and Leverage Management DegenFi introduces automated closing mechanisms and auto-management of leverage to prevent users from facing forced liquidation due to sharp market movements:

  • Auto-Close: In the options market, if a position hits a pre-set profit or loss threshold, the system automatically closes out to lock in gains or limit losses.

  • Auto Leverage Adjustment: During periods of high volatility, DegenFi can reduce a user’s leverage multiple to curb risk exposure. Users may also enable auto debt repayment to avoid forced liquidation when interest accrues.

  1. Decentralized Options Market DegenFi offers a decentralized options trading platform where users can create, trade, and customize options:

  • Customizable Contracts: Users can set parameters such as expiration date, strike price, and underlying asset to tailor their options strategies.

  • Decentralized Settlement: All trades are executed via smart contracts, eliminating centralized risks and ensuring transparency, reliability, and immutability.
